Project Type Typical Range
Partial Wall Removal $1,200 - $2,000
Full Wall Demolition $2,000 - $3,500
Chimney Demolition $1,500 - $2,800
Fireplace Removal $1,200 - $2,200
Exterior Masonry Removal $2,000 - $4,000
Foundation Demolition $4,000 - $8,000
Cost estimates depend on project specifics. Use these guides to understand typical masonry demolition costs in Brick, NJ.

Factors Affecting Demolition Costs

Demolishing masonry structures in Brick, NJ, involves various factors that influence project costs and scope. Understanding typical considerations can help in planning and comparison for masonry demolition projects, whether removing brick walls, chimneys, or other masonry features.

  • Materials: Primarily brick, stone, or concrete, which may vary in density and difficulty of removal.
  • Size and Scope: Ranges from small sections of brickwork to entire walls or structures, affecting labor and equipment needs.
  • Labor Complexity: Depends on the thickness, age, and construction method of the masonry, influencing demolition techniques used.
  • Permitting: Local regulations in Brick, NJ, may require permits for structural or large-scale demolitions.
  • Additional Services: Disposal, debris removal, and site cleanup are often part of masonry demolition projects.
